The FieldDefinitionList class is used to hold the field definitions that will be used to populate an AutoFormPanel with input controls. The class is descended from List<BaseFieldDefinition>, and adds two utility methods.


 public void InsertAfterProperty(BaseFieldDefinition fieldDefinition,
            String afterPropertyName) 
This method inserts the given field definition instance into the list directly after the given property name.

public BaseFieldDefinition DefinitionForPropertyName(String propertyName)
This method returns the field definition object for the given property name. If no matching definition is found the method returns null.

Last edited Oct 20, 2014 at 7:50 AM by DevKnightlie, version 1